Q: Tell us a little about the city and community God has called you to reach.

"Atlantic City is a unique mission field, home to many individuals struggling with addiction, poverty, and homelessness. We have had the privilege of building relationships with those who are hurting and often have nowhere else to turn. At the same time, we are witnessing our city transform with new developments and businesses emerging that are bringing new residents in. We believe God has strategically placed Atlantic City Baptist Church here for such a time as this. Every person, whether struggling to find their next meal or moving into a brand-new development, needs the hope of the Gospel. Our desire is to reach every soul in Atlantic City by loving on people, building relationships, and faithfully pointing them to Christ."

Q: What have been some of the most encouraging moments from your first year?

"Over this past year, God has blessed us with countless moments that remind us of His goodness and power. From local churches joining together to help us launch with a citywide crusade, to weekly decisions being made for Christ, to the joy of serving side by side with my wife and children, every memory reflects God’s hand at work. One of the most special highlights was our first baptism service, when twelve individuals publicly followed the Lord in baptism. Each life represents a unique story of grace and transformation and is a testimony to what God is doing in Atlantic City. We’ve also seen around 30–40 people begin attending services faithfully, becoming part of our church family and serving alongside us. It’s been incredible to watch God build relationships, change hearts, and give us the opportunity to walk alongside people as they grow in Christ."

Q: What has been one of the greatest challenges you've faced during your first year?

"One of our greatest challenges this past year has been finding a stable place to meet. Although God graciously provided a building where we have been able to establish a meeting location, restrictions surrounding churches in Atlantic City have made finding a long-term location difficult and limited our options. Currently, we are unable to meet earlier in the day on Sundays, and because of future plans for the building, we are not guaranteed the use of our current location much longer. Transportation is also a significant challenge in our community, as many of the people we are reaching do not have reliable access to a vehicle. We currently pick up approximately 90% of our congregation each week and bring them to church. As we look toward the future, we are praying for God to provide a permanent place to meet and the resources necessary to continue bringing people to church and reaching Atlantic City with the Gospel."
